Taschenbuch. Zustand: Neu. Neuware - In today's tumultuous age photography has become a pervasive pursuit. Everywhere you look everyone seems to have a camera and everyone seems to be taking passionate photos on favourite themes, selected subjects and preferred people, who personally spark their wide-eyed interest. As with anything in life, the importance is not in the accomplishment of what photography can do (for you), but rather in the love which you bring to the art of photography. The transformative photographer must approach his subject with a comprehensive, evolutionary, detached but warm love, coupled with humour and an ability to leave things unaltered and fundamentally free.
